sql >> データベース >  >> RDS >> Sqlserver

特定のデータベースから接頭辞 bkp を持つすべてのテーブルを削除するには?

    これを試してください:

    USE C
    GO
    
    SELECT
    'DROP TABLE ' + name
    FROM sys.tables
    WHERE create_date >= '20101211'   -- substitute your date you're interested in
    AND name like 'bkp%'
    

    これにより、出力として DROP TABLE:.... のリストが作成されます ステートメント - それらをコピーして、新しい SSMS ウィンドウに貼り付けて実行します。これで完了です!




    1. Possibilites @mysql_affected_rowsは値を返しますか?

    2. SQL Server がシリアル化アセンブリを見つけられない

    3. PostgreSQLでは、COPYコマンドでデータを挿入する方法は?

    4. データモデリングにおけるERD表記